Overview Job Summary Performs maintenance, installations, and repairs of equipment and building support systems that are necessary to the operation of the plant and offices at the facility. Essential Duties/Responsibilities Works on job duties and assignments as they relate to maintenance, repair, installing, fabricating, adjusting, troubleshooting, and any other maintenance duties as needed. Responsible for scheduled preventive maintenance checks. Responsible for departmental inventory control. Diagnose & resolve equipment malfunctions and operating difficulties related to, but not limited to, cranes/hoists, 3 phase motors, chillers, cooling towers, boilers, HVA units, pumps, exhaust fans, etc. Perform mechanical, electrical and plumbing operations. Performs start-up and shut down functions on plant equipment and facilities as required. Responds to emergency calls on a twenty-four-hour basis. Works consistently to resolve sited safety issues in a timely manner. Responsible for maintaining departmental documentation as required. Workings safely at all times in compliance with OSHA safety and EPA regulations. Adheres to all Quality System procedures and work instructions. Participate in the handling, labeling, containment and disposal of hazardous waste. Performs other miscellaneous job duties and related functions as needed. Physical/Environmental/Chemical Hazards Sharp parts, sharp tooling, heaving carts, seasonal high temperature and humidity levels, working at heights, moderate noise levels, limited hand and air tool use, compressed air (must use hearing protection). Must be able to wear respiratory protection when required. Must be able to lift 30-50 lbs. unassisted. Potential splash exposure near process lines. Various chemicals used in process. Education/Qualifications High School diploma or equivalent preferred but not required. Requires broad based knowledge of electrical, mechanical and plumbing acquired through hands on training. Technical degree with a minimum of two (2) years work-related experience preferred. Strong oral and written communication skills. Blueprint & schematic knowledge helpful.
